JS表白代碼

簡單的JS彈窗表白代碼

思路:只有當用戶輸入1(表示喜歡你)纔有進一步瀏覽的資格。如果用戶輸入2(不喜歡你)就會陷入死循環進行撒嬌,只有當用戶輸入1,纔可以跳出循環,進入瀏覽界面。
然後瀏覽界面有個button按鈕,點擊它就會彈出愛心!!!
下面是完整的代碼: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>luzelong</title>
    <style>
        body {
            background-color: pink;
        }
        *{
            font-size:60px;
            color: red;
        }
        button {
                background-color:bisque;
                border-radius: 6px;
        }
    </style>
    <script>
        alert('這裏是愛的世界入口,但你必須通過考驗才能繼續瀏覽');
        function pow(){
            
            while(true){
                alert('我很失望....');
                U=prompt('你喜歡我(是就輸入1,不是的話:嘿嘿嘿)');
                if(U=='1')break;
            }
        }
        function S(){
            W=prompt('我勸你再好好想想吧,在給你一次機會(同意請輸入1,不同意請輸入2)');
            switch(W){
            case '1':alert('這就很奈斯了!嘻嘻嘻');break;
            case '2':pow();break;
            default:alert('你的輸入有誤,請重新輸入!!!');
                    S();
        }
        }
        function A(){
        B=prompt('你喜歡我嗎?(喜歡請輸入1,不喜歡請輸入2)');
        switch(B){
            case '1':alert('很高興被你喜歡,你有資格資格繼續瀏覽');break;
            case '2':S();break;
            default:alert('你的輸入有誤,請重新輸入!!!');
                    A();
        }
        }
        A();
    </script>
    
</head>
<body>
    <p style="color:aqua;   font-family: Arial, Helvetica, sans-serif;">我要表達的內容如下:</p>
    <button type="button" onclick="ass()">點我點我!!!
 <script>
     function ass(){
        for (var y = 1.5; y > -1.5; y -= 0.1) {
        for (var x = -1.5; x < 1.5; x += 0.05) {
            var a = x * x + y * y - 1;
            if(a * a * a - x * x * y * y * y <= 0.0)
            document.write('*');
            else
            document.write('&nbsp;');
        }
        document.write('<br/>');
    }
    document.write('&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;希望我們長長久久!');
     }
 </script>
 
</body>
</html>

優化了一下: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>luzelong</title>
    <style>
        body {
            background-color: pink;
        }
        *{
            font-size:60px;
            color: red;
        }
        button {
                background-color:bisque;
                border-radius: 6px;
        }
    </style>
    <script>
        alert('有一句話憋在心裏很久了--我喜歡你~');
        function pow(){
            alert('希望你能遇到一個你愛的人和愛你的人吧,對你只有祝福了~');
            while(true){
                alert('關掉這個頁面吧,裏面隱藏的內容只有你也喜歡我才能看見,抱歉了!');
            }
        }
        function S(){
            W=prompt('真的不願意給我一個機會嗎,我會爲了你努力變的更優秀的(同意請輸入1,不同意請輸入2)');
            switch(W){
            case '1':alert('哇哦!我真的很開心~');break;
            case '2':pow();break;
            default:alert('你的輸入有誤,請重新輸入!!!');
                    S();
        }
        }
        function A(){
        B=prompt('請相信我的一片真心,能給我個機會嗎?(給請輸入1,不給請輸入2)');
        switch(B){
            case '1':alert('哇哦!我真的很開心~');break;
            case '2':S();break;
            default:alert('你的輸入有誤,請重新輸入!!!');
                    A();
        }
        }
        A();

        function qq(){
            alert("關閉該頁面前,我想說————永遠愛你!");
        }
    </script>
    
</head>
<body onunload="qq()">
    <p style="color:aqua;   font-family: Arial, Helvetica, sans-serif;">你能看到這個頁面,說明我還是很幸運的</p>
    <button type="button" onclick="ass()">點我點我!!!
 <script>
     function ass(){
        for (var y = 1.5; y > -1.5; y -= 0.1) {
        for (var x = -1.5; x < 1.5; x += 0.05) {
            var a = x * x + y * y - 1;
            if(a * a * a - x * x * y * y * y <= 0.0)
            document.write('*');
            else
            document.write('&nbsp;');
        }
        document.write('<br/>');
    }
    document.write('&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;希望我們長長久久!<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;盧澤龍');
     }
 </script>
 
</body>
</html>

未經博主許可!不許轉載!!!

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章